SaaS advertising has a problem that most marketing teams know well. Your product is powerful, but explaining it in a single image or a 15-second video is genuinely hard. You need creatives for free trial pushes, feature announcements, competitor comparisons, onboarding flows, and retargeting sequences, all running simultaneously across different audiences. That volume of creative work can grind even a well-resourced team to a halt.
AI ad creative tools change the equation. Instead of waiting on designers or cycling through endless revision rounds, you can generate image ads, video ads, and copy variations in minutes, test more concepts faster, and let performance data tell you what actually converts.
The catch is that not every tool is built for the demands of SaaS performance marketing. Some are great for static images but weak on video. Others generate creatives but leave you to figure out campaign management on your own. The tools below were selected for their creative quality, format variety, testing capabilities, platform integrations, and pricing that works for SaaS budgets at both the growth and enterprise stage.

2. AdCreative.ai
Best for: Teams that need high volumes of conversion-focused static ad creatives quickly.
AdCreative.ai is an AI-powered creative platform trained on a large dataset of high-performing ads, designed to generate visuals and copy that are optimized for conversion from the start.
Where This Tool Shines
AdCreative.ai has built its core value around one idea: creatives trained on what actually converts. The platform uses its training data to score generated creatives before you spend a dollar, giving you a predictive signal on which assets are worth testing. For SaaS teams running frequent campaigns, this can meaningfully reduce the guesswork in early creative selection.
The brand kit integration keeps visual consistency across generated assets, which matters when you are producing creatives at scale and need everything to look like it came from the same marketing team.
Key Features
Conversion-Trained AI: Creatives are generated using models trained on millions of high-performing ads, with scoring to predict performance before launch.
Brand Kit Integration: Upload your brand colors, fonts, and logo to keep all generated creatives visually consistent.
Creative Scoring: Each generated asset receives a performance score so you can prioritize which creatives to test first.
Text and Headline Generation: Generates ad copy and headlines alongside visuals so you get complete ad units, not just images.
Best For
SaaS marketing teams that primarily need static ad creatives at volume and want built-in performance scoring to guide creative selection. A good fit for teams without dedicated designers who still need professional-quality output consistently.
Pricing
Starter plans begin around $29/month, making it one of the more accessible entry points in this category for early-stage SaaS companies.
3. Pencil (by Brandtech)
Best for: Performance marketers who want predictive AI scoring and competitive creative intelligence before committing ad spend.
Pencil is an AI creative platform that generates video and static ad creatives while using predictive scoring and competitive benchmarking to help teams make smarter decisions before campaigns go live.
Where This Tool Shines
Pencil's differentiator is its emphasis on prediction. Rather than just generating creatives and hoping for the best, the platform scores assets against performance benchmarks before any budget is spent. For SaaS companies running competitive campaigns where cost per acquisition matters, this front-loaded intelligence can reduce wasted spend on creatives that were unlikely to perform.
The competitive creative analysis feature is also worth noting. Being able to benchmark your creatives against what competitors are running gives SaaS marketers a useful strategic reference point, particularly in crowded categories where differentiation is everything.
Key Features
Predictive AI Scoring: Scores creatives against performance benchmarks before any ad spend is committed, helping teams prioritize their strongest assets.
Automated Video Generation: Produces video ad creatives from existing assets without requiring video editing expertise or additional production resources.
Competitive Creative Analysis: Benchmarks your creative output against competitor ad activity to surface differentiation opportunities.
Platform Integrations: Connects with Meta, TikTok, and other major ad platforms for streamlined publishing workflows.
Best For
Mid-market and enterprise SaaS teams that prioritize data-informed creative decisions and want competitive intelligence built into their creative workflow. Best suited for teams with existing creative assets to feed into the generation process.
Pricing
Enterprise-oriented pricing with custom quotes based on usage and team size. Contact Pencil directly for current pricing details.
4. Creatopy
Best for: SaaS teams that need design automation with strong multi-format support and team collaboration built in.
Creatopy is a design automation platform built for producing, personalizing, and scaling ad creatives across multiple formats and channels simultaneously.
Where This Tool Shines
Creatopy handles the operational side of ad creative production particularly well. Its smart resizing automatically adapts a single design across dozens of ad formats, which is a real time-saver when SaaS teams need creatives for Meta feed ads, Stories, display banners, and LinkedIn all from the same campaign concept.
The team collaboration and brand management tools make it a strong choice for SaaS companies where multiple stakeholders need to review, approve, and maintain brand consistency across creative output. Animated and HTML5 ad support also extends its usefulness beyond standard static formats.
Key Features
AI-Powered Design Automation: Smart resizing and layout adaptation across ad formats reduces manual production work significantly.
Rich Template Library: Includes SaaS-friendly layouts designed for product-focused advertising across social and display channels.
Animated and HTML5 Ad Support: Enables motion-based and interactive ad formats beyond standard static images.
Team Collaboration Tools: Built-in review, approval, and brand governance workflows for teams with multiple contributors.
Best For
SaaS marketing teams that run ads across multiple channels and need consistent, on-brand creatives at scale without a full design team. Also well-suited for agencies managing several SaaS clients who need efficient brand management across accounts.
Pricing
Plans start around $36/month, with higher tiers available for larger teams and higher creative volume requirements.
5. Canva Magic Studio
Best for: SaaS teams that need accessible, versatile creative production without a steep learning curve.
Canva Magic Studio is Canva's AI-powered creative suite, adding text-to-image generation, AI video editing, and intelligent design tools to its already extensive template library.
Where This Tool Shines
Canva's strength is accessibility. For SaaS companies where marketers, product managers, and founders all need to produce creative assets without waiting on a designer, Magic Studio lowers the barrier significantly. The AI tools layer on top of an interface that most people already know, which means adoption is fast and the learning curve is minimal.
The breadth of ad templates covering social, display, and video formats means you can produce a wide variety of creative assets from a single tool. Brand Kit integration keeps everything looking consistent even when multiple team members are creating assets independently.
Key Features
Magic Studio AI Tools: Includes text-to-image generation, background removal, Magic Animate, and AI-assisted design suggestions across all creative types.
Extensive Template Library: Thousands of ad templates spanning social, display, and video formats with SaaS-relevant options available.
Brand Kit: Stores brand colors, fonts, and logos to maintain visual consistency across all team-generated assets.
Accessible Interface: Designed for non-designers, making it practical for cross-functional SaaS teams where creative production is a shared responsibility.
Best For
Early-stage SaaS teams, founders, and small marketing teams that need to produce a wide variety of creative assets quickly without specialized design skills. Also useful as a supplementary tool for larger teams that need quick turnaround on simple assets.
Pricing
Free tier available with core features. Canva Pro is $15/month per user, making it one of the most cost-effective options in this list for small teams.
6. Predis.ai
Best for: SaaS teams that want complete social ad posts generated from a single text prompt, including visuals, copy, and captions.
Predis.ai is an AI content generator that produces complete social media ad posts with visuals, captions, copy, and hashtags from a single text input.
Where This Tool Shines
The appeal of Predis.ai is simplicity at the output level. Rather than generating just an image or just copy, it produces a complete, ready-to-publish ad post from a single prompt. For SaaS teams that need to maintain a consistent social advertising presence without dedicating significant time to content creation, this all-in-one output is genuinely useful.
The competitor analysis feature adds a strategic dimension, letting you see what content competitors are producing and use that as a reference when planning your own creative direction.
Key Features
Complete Ad Post Generation: Produces visuals, captions, copy, and hashtags from a single text input for a fully assembled ad post.
AI Video and Carousel Ads: Generates video and multi-image carousel formats in addition to standard static posts.
Competitor Analysis: Surfaces competitor content and benchmarks to inform your own creative strategy.
Scheduling and Publishing: Integrated scheduling tools let you plan and publish content directly from the platform.
Best For
SaaS companies with active social advertising programs that need consistent creative output without heavy production overhead. Works well for teams managing multiple social channels who need volume without sacrificing quality.
Pricing
Plans start around $29/month, with higher tiers available for greater output volume and team access.
7. Superside
Best for: Enterprise SaaS teams that need high-quality, on-brand creative production at scale with human design oversight.
Superside is an AI-enhanced creative-as-a-service platform that combines AI tools with a global network of professional designers for high-volume, brand-consistent ad production.
Where This Tool Shines
Superside occupies a different position from the other tools on this list. Rather than replacing designers with AI, it uses AI to augment a team of professional creatives, which means output quality is consistently high and brand governance is built into the workflow. For enterprise SaaS companies where brand integrity and creative quality are non-negotiable, this hybrid approach is compelling.
The fast turnaround on complex creative formats, including motion graphics and video, makes it practical for SaaS teams running campaigns that require production values beyond what pure AI tools can reliably deliver.
Key Features
AI-Augmented Creative Workflows: AI tools accelerate production while human designers maintain quality control and brand consistency.
Dedicated Creative Team: Assigned design resources with fast turnaround times for ongoing campaign needs.
Full Format Range: Handles motion graphics, video, static ads, and more across all major ad platforms and formats.
Enterprise Brand Governance: Approval workflows and brand management tools designed for larger organizations with multiple stakeholders.
Best For
Enterprise SaaS marketing teams with significant creative budgets that prioritize quality and brand consistency above all else. Also a strong fit for SaaS companies launching major campaigns where production values need to match the scale of the investment.
Pricing
Custom pricing based on creative scope and volume. Contact Superside directly for a quote tailored to your team's needs.
8. Hunch
Best for: SaaS teams that need personalized, data-driven paid social ads at scale with dynamic creative automation.
Hunch is a dynamic creative automation platform that produces personalized paid social ads by connecting creative templates to live data feeds.
Where This Tool Shines
Hunch is built for personalization at scale. By connecting creative templates to data feeds, it can automatically generate ad variations tailored to specific audiences, geographies, or product configurations without manual intervention for each variant. For SaaS companies with multiple product tiers, regional markets, or audience segments, this automation can dramatically reduce the production overhead of maintaining relevant creative across all those variables.
The direct Meta integration streamlines publishing, and the creative analytics dashboard gives you clear visibility into which dynamic variations are actually performing.
Key Features
Dynamic Creative Templates: Templates connect to data feeds to automatically generate personalized ad variations at scale.
Automated Localization and Personalization: Produces audience-specific and geography-specific creative variations without manual production for each variant.
Direct Meta Integration: Streamlined publishing workflow directly to Meta for faster campaign deployment.
Creative Analytics Dashboard: Performance tracking across dynamic creative variations to identify which personalizations are driving results.
Best For
Mid-market and enterprise SaaS companies with multiple product lines, regional markets, or complex audience segmentation that requires personalized creative at scale. Best suited for teams with structured data feeds to power dynamic templates.
Pricing
Enterprise pricing with custom quotes based on usage volume and team requirements. Contact Hunch directly for current pricing details.
9. Re:nable (formerly Marpipe)
Best for: SaaS teams that want systematic, data-driven multivariate creative testing to identify exactly which ad elements drive performance.
Re:nable is a multivariate creative testing platform that builds and tests every combination of ad creative elements systematically to surface clear performance winners.
Where This Tool Shines
Re:nable takes a methodical approach to creative optimization that most other tools do not match. Instead of generating a batch of creatives and running them against each other, it breaks ads down into modular elements, headlines, images, CTAs, color schemes, and tests every possible combination systematically. The result is clear attribution: you know not just which ad won, but which specific elements drove the win.
For SaaS companies that are serious about creative learning and want to build a compounding knowledge base about what resonates with their audience, this structured approach to testing is genuinely valuable.
Key Features
Automated Multivariate Creative Generation: Builds every combination of modular creative elements automatically, removing the manual work of creating individual test variants.
Systematic Variable Testing: Tests every creative combination in a structured way to produce statistically meaningful results rather than anecdotal wins.
Element-Level Performance Attribution: Identifies which specific creative elements (headline, image, CTA, etc.) are driving performance, not just which overall ad won.
Platform Integration: Connects with Meta and other major ad platforms for streamlined test deployment and results tracking.
Best For
Data-driven SaaS marketing teams that want to build systematic creative intelligence over time. Ideal for companies willing to invest in structured testing to develop a clear, evidence-based understanding of their best-performing creative elements.
Pricing
Pricing varies based on creative volume and testing scale. Contact Re:nable directly for pricing that fits your testing program.
